Chapter 265

When Curtis arrived, the party was already in full swing.

The villa was warm with the scent of wine. As he entered, a chill from the spring night clung to him.

Spotting him at the door, a group who had been slapping playing cards on their faces and standing up to greet him dropped their cards, “Curtis.”

“Carry on,” Curtis said, walking straight past them.

Leanne was still asleep on the couch.

If she was anyone else, Devin would’ve just tossed her into an empty room upstairs to sleep it off, but it was not the case for Leanne. He draped a blanket over her and stayed by her side, wary of any drunken partygoers accidentally bumping into her.

He leaned against the couch, nearly dozing off himself. Suddenly, he realized the couch. and Leanne were both empty.

Devin sprang up, “Where’s Leanne?”

Someone nearly dropped their drink, “Geez, don’t scare me like that. Curtis just carried her off.”

Despite the warmer days, the nights in March were still cold.

Curtis wrapped Leanne snugly in the blanket, carrying her out princess-style. She seemed to wake up as they stepped outside.

Barely opening her eyes, she looked at him through a haze.

Curtis hadn’t expected her to wake so soon, wondering if she’d think he broke his promise of not showing up.

“Go back to sleep,” he said softly. “When you wake up, I won’t be here.”

She didn’t respond and just looked at him for a moment longer.

“Curtis,” she said, her voice soft and slightly slurred, not quite her usual tone.

“It’s snowing.”
